一:为什么需要Sort-Based Shuffle?
1,? Shuffle一般包含两个阶段任务:
第一部分:产生Shuffle数据的阶段(Map阶段,额外补充,需要实现ShuffleManager中的getWriter来写数据(数据可以通过BlockManager写到Memory,Disk,Tachyon
分类:
其他 时间:
2016-04-30 02:23:24
收藏:
0 评论:
0 赞:
0 阅读:
409
有时候当我们从前台提交大量的数据到服务器时,由于服务器处理的时间较长,这个时候我们在浏览器中看到的是一片空白,不知道后台程序是否成功执行了,这个时候就设置一个友好的信息交互界面(比如在界面上提示系统正在处理等信息)来提示用户。
(1) 在struts2中,实现该功能的是使用execAndWait拦截器,它的具体实现过程如下:
1、当表单提交请求到来时,execAndWait拦截器将创建一个新的 ...
分类:
其他 时间:
2016-04-30 02:22:34
收藏:
0 评论:
0 赞:
0 阅读:
490
“庙小妖风大,水浅王八多”。还是这句话,这是业余研究生的文本建模系列之二:关于pLSA。前述就到此。
?
pLSA:Probabilistic Latent Senmantic Indexing.是Hoffman在1999年提出的基于概率的隐语义分析【1】。之所以说是probabilistic,是因为这个模型中还加入了一个隐变量:主题Z ,也正因为此,它被称之为主题模型。
?
在pLSA ...
分类:
其他 时间:
2016-04-30 02:22:08
收藏:
0 评论:
0 赞:
0 阅读:
441
mvc模式--基本是公司面试的必选题目,我面试的,也有从培训机构出来的,但是还是觉得他们的回答欠缺了一些。
?
这个题目的要点如下:如果你是回答,要单词解释,要一针见血,再具体解释。有具体的应用更好MVC思想,模式,1、解释M:model,模型,完成具体业务逻辑(包括数据库的crud操作和其他一些常规操作,如文件上传,验证码)V:view,视图,显示用户的交互界面C:controller,控制 ...
分类:
Web开发 时间:
2016-04-30 02:21:43
收藏:
0 评论:
0 赞:
0 阅读:
308
jq文档的说明是
1、after函数
定义和用法:
after() 方法在被选元素后插入指定的内容。
语法:
$(selector).after(content)
实例:
<html><head><script type="text/JavaScript" src="/jQuery/jquery.js" ...
分类:
移动平台 时间:
2016-04-30 02:21:18
收藏:
0 评论:
0 赞:
0 阅读:
349
js
document.onmousedown=function(e){
var target = e.target;
//alert(target.id);
var sea = target.getAttribute("sea");
if(sea!="sea"){
if(get("seaLis ...
分类:
Web开发 时间:
2016-04-30 02:20:53
收藏:
0 评论:
0 赞:
0 阅读:
313
Oracle版本平台兼容性列表
?
If your oracle database encountered? problems on a specific compatible linux platform, oracle company will give a solution to ensure ODB smooth running.?On the other hand, installi ...
分类:
数据库技术 时间:
2016-04-30 02:20:28
收藏:
0 评论:
0 赞:
0 阅读:
967
最近在研究blockqueue的源码,从今天开始,和大家分享一下我看源码的一些心得体会
? ? ?(1)LinkedBlockingQueue源码解析
? ? ?(2)ArrayBlockingQueue源码解析
? ??
? ? ?LinkedBlockingQueue实现了BlockingQueue接口以及Serializable接口,是有序的FIFO队列,构造函数中,可传 ...
分类:
数据库技术 时间:
2016-04-30 02:20:03
收藏:
0 评论:
0 赞:
0 阅读:
587
动态流量切换路由降级方案之设计篇
nginx动态负载upstream四种方案之调研篇
? ??
动态流量切换路由降级方案之实现篇
1.流程图:
?
? ? ? ? ??
共享内存配置同步持久化到nginx.conf
?
?
?
?
cli操作方式:
? ? ?
? ? ? ???
? ? ? ??
3.web方式操作
?
?adjx 式交互
?
?
总结 ...
分类:
其他 时间:
2016-04-30 02:19:13
收藏:
0 评论:
0 赞:
0 阅读:
444
Kafka原理图JAVA源代码之kafka生产者,本次客户端使用kafka的console命令行,消费,生产者使用代码编码。看了好多生产者代码都带有props.put("zk.connect",?"n2:2181/jafka");??真是感到不解,没有这个参数也可以运行的好好的,实践出真知,弄懂原理真的很重要,具体如下:
import java.util ...
分类:
编程语言 时间:
2016-04-30 02:18:23
收藏:
0 评论:
0 赞:
0 阅读:
288
本地导入dmp文件比较简单,远程导入有点儿坑,打开cmd-输入下面语句
? ??
imp 用户名/密码@客户端服务名 BUFFER=64000 FILE=C:\Users\Alber
t\Desktop\导入文件.dmp fromuser=用户A touser=用户B ignore=y
?切记@后面的服务名不是服务器上Oracle 的服务名,而是本地客户端你对应的服务名;如果当 ...
分类:
数据库技术 时间:
2016-04-30 02:17:58
收藏:
0 评论:
0 赞:
0 阅读:
299
eclipse启动web项目突然出现如下异常,?
java.lang.LinkageError: loader constraint violation: loader (instance of org/apache/catalina/loader/WebappClassLoader) previously initiated loading for a different type with ...
分类:
系统服务 时间:
2016-04-30 02:17:34
收藏:
0 评论:
0 赞:
0 阅读:
418
Hadoop Cluster启动后数据节点(DataNode)进程状态丢失
?
在拥有三个节点的Hadoop集群环境中,其各节点的配置为:CPU Intel(R) Core(TM) i3-3120M CPU@2.50GHz 2.50GHz,内存RAM 6GB,Operation System Redhat Linux 5 x86-64bit.
首先通过命令hadoop dfs nameno ...
分类:
系统服务 时间:
2016-04-30 02:17:08
收藏:
0 评论:
0 赞:
0 阅读:
1450
最近一直在研究怎么实现分布式事务,花了不少时间,测试工程启停测试了无数次,最终实现的时候其实也就是写一些配置文件,对于工程代码没什么影响。目前研究还不是很深入,对于全面崩溃恢复如何实现和测试还不清楚。本文先介绍基础的实现。
?
当业务需要在一个事务中操作多个不同的资源,例如多个数据库,消息队列,缓存等,那么就需要使用分布式事务了。在java中一般建议使用JTA,这样开发人员就不用关心什么叫X ...
分类:
其他 时间:
2016-04-30 02:16:45
收藏:
0 评论:
0 赞:
0 阅读:
357
.抽象类语法特点??? 1.使用abstract关键字修饰??? 2.有抽象方法的类一定是抽象类,抽象类不一定有抽象方法??? ?也就是抽象类可以有抽象方法,也可以有具体方法
??? 3.抽象类不能实例化,但可以作为子类对象引用??? 4.子类继承抽象类,必须要实现所有的抽象方法。否则他也是抽象类??? 5.抽象类可以有构造器(方便子类实例化调用),属性无限制??? 6.抽象类可以继承抽象类,抽 ...
分类:
其他 时间:
2016-04-30 02:16:18
收藏:
0 评论:
0 赞:
0 阅读:
318
Spring使用groovy作为bean,官方用了lang标签,但都是一个个文件。Groovy本身编译成class文件后当然可以和Java完全一样可以被component-scan。
?
但是我想实现能够扫描groovy文件,并且groovy文件发生修改时候能够重新load(方便开发环境中提高效率),网上查查了,然后自己摸索了下,简单实现了。
?
思路:
1. 通过NamespaceHa ...
分类:
编程语言 时间:
2016-04-30 02:15:28
收藏:
0 评论:
0 赞:
0 阅读:
582
短连接:
所谓短连接指建立SOCKET连接后发送后接收完数据后马上断开连接,一般银行都使用短连接解释2长连接就是指在基于tcp的通讯中,一直保持连接,不管当前是否发送或者接收数据。而短连接就是只有在有数据传输的时候才进行连接,客户-服务器通信/传输数据完毕就关闭连接。
长连接:
解释3长连接和短连接这个概念好像只有移动的CMPP协议中提到了,其他的地方没有看到过。通信方式各网元之间共有两种连 ...
分类:
其他 时间:
2016-04-30 02:15:03
收藏:
0 评论:
0 赞:
0 阅读:
295
Oracle 隐含参数_asm_hbeatiowait引起的ASM磁盘组DISMOUNT
?
(1)恒生电子资管云HOMS系统B区2015年3月6日上午故障现象:【数据库服务器无法连接】
(2)恒生电子资管云HOMS系统B区2015年3月9日下午故障现象:【数据库服务器无法连接】
分类:
数据库技术 时间:
2016-04-30 02:14:38
收藏:
0 评论:
0 赞:
0 阅读:
3057
学习go的过程中,会把GOROOT 和 GOPATH两个路径容易弄混,这里做下笔记。
?
go的安装这里不赘述,详细请看官方文档:https://golang.org/doc/install
?
安装完go之后,需要配置两个环境变量:
?
GOROOT:go的安装路径,比如默认会在/usr/local/go;
GOPATH : ?go代码的工作路径,比如 $HOME/mywo ...
分类:
其他 时间:
2016-04-30 02:13:48
收藏:
0 评论:
0 赞:
0 阅读:
273
原文出自【听云技术博客】:http://blog.tingyun.com/web/article/detail/516
?
Charles是一款抓包修改工具,相比起TcpDump,charles具有界面简单直观,易于上手,数据请求控制容易,修改简单,抓取数据的开始暂停方便等等优势!前面介绍了如何使用TcpDump抓包,下面给大家介绍一下Charles的使用。
Charles抓包
Charl ...
分类:
移动平台 时间:
2016-04-30 02:13:25
收藏:
0 评论:
0 赞:
0 阅读:
426